Transaction 7a046405e98870562a7956b1975595a4b30f93584bb8d4c14d08876c242695e6
1 Input
1 Output
-
7a046405e98870562a7956b1975595a4b30f93584bb8d4c14d08876c242695e6:0
- value
- 498265
- script pubkey
- OP_0 OP_PUSHBYTES_20 e70512338a8ce795eefe19b2e620059f8ef0a932
- address
- bc1quuz3yvu23nnetmh7rxewvgq9n780p2fjvttuz5